TABLE 5.

Summary of results for strain properties and tests in vitro for isolates in each of the four main C. albicans clades

Strain property or test result Value for isolates in:
Clade 1 (n = 14) Clade 2 (n = 10) Clade 3 (n = 8) Clade 4 (n = 11)
Type A,a no. of isolates (% of clade) 14 (100) 10 (100) 0 (0) 2 (18)
Type B,a no. of isolates (% of clade) 0 (0) 0 (0) 8 (100) 4 (36)
Type C,a no. of isolates (% of clade) 0 (0) 0 (0) 0 (0) 5 (45)
μmax (mean ± SEM) (h−1) in RPMI 1640 at the following temp:
    30°C 0.15 ± 0.01 0.16 ± 0.01 0.16 ± 0.01 0.14 ± 0.01
    37°C 0.23 ± 0.01 0.20 ± 0.01 0.22 ± 0.02 0.22 ± 0.02
    40°C 0.13 ± 0.01 0.15 ± 0.01 0.13 ± 0.01 0.13 ± 0.01
Biofilm formation (mean ± SEM) (supernatant OD600) 0.017 ± 0.004 0.027 ± 0.006 0.037 ± 0.030 0.191 ± 0.095
Growth (mean ± SEM) (OD600) in YCB-BSAb at 30°C 0.13 ± 0.13 0.36 ± 0.07 0.27 ± 0.17 0.37 ± 0.14
Acid phosphatase sp acta (mean ± SEM) (nmol/15 min/OD600) 740 ± 190 250 ± 40 600 ± 80 640 ± 110
Alcian blue (mean ± SEM) (μg bound per cell OD600) 94 ± 6 110 ± 10 80 ± 2 90 ± 9
Growth in 2 M NaCl,a no. of isolates (% of clade) 13 (93) 4 (40) 1 (13) 2 (18)
No. of BECs positive for C. albicans (mean ± SEM) 28 ± 1.4 27 ± 1.9 35 ± 2.5 26 ± 1.6
No. of C. albicans per BEC (mean ± SEM) 2.0 ± 0.1 2.0 ± 0.1 2.1 ± 0.2 1.8 ± 0.1
Adherence to catheter plastic (mean ± SEM) (% reduction Alamar blue per g catheter) 1.2 ± 0.1 1.2 ± 0.1 1.3 ± 0.1 1.2 ± 0.1
a

These properties were significantly different between clades (Kruskall-Wallis test, P < 0.01).

b

YCB-BSA, yeast carbon base with bovine serum albumin.
